Provenance: Tallysweep Reconciliation Job

Each nightly run is built from a pinned commit, hermetic deps, signed at publish. Reviewers: verify the attestation matches the manifest digest before approving promotion. No unsigned runs reach production. The canonical token for the current approved build appears below.

pipeline stamp: htk9_ce63042d9

Day-one task: find the evacuation-chair store! It's the grey cupboard on Level 3 by the north stairwell at Quillbrook House — worth knowing before you need it. Have a quick look inside so you know what the chair looks like, and read the laminated card on the door. Your floor warden (ask for whoever's wearing the orange lanyard) will show you the basics. The store stays locked, so to open it you'll need the code below.

turnstile pass: bdg-M-14

When the PortionWise recipe-scaling calculator's admin account is locked (typically after a failed SSO migration or three bad TOTP entries), do not recreate the account; doing so orphans the unit-conversion tables. Instead, start the recovery console from the maintenance host, confirm the database snapshot is less than 24 hours old, and select "restore admin session." The console will prompt twice: first for your operator name, then for the recovery credential. At the second prompt, enter the passphrase shown below exactly as written.

unlock words, kawig-fawig: frawyn-soriel-ralok-casdor-sorwyn-casdor-novdor-kasvan-siliel-aldath-feniel-ulaath-zorwyn

Quick heads-up for new support folks at Birchloom: we never hard-delete rows in the orders table. Deletions just flip a deleted_at timestamp, so "gone" orders are still queryable with the admin flag. To run the restore tool locally, copy .env.example to .env, fill in the database host, and then add the restore-service token right below this sentence.

sealed setting: VAULT_KEY20=c8ea1e419912889df6b4

Quick notes for this week's Lanternflag release. We're bumping the rollout engine to 4.2, which changes how percentage buckets hash — flags pinned by the Merrow team stay frozen until they confirm. Ramp order: internal, then the Oakhollow canary ring, then everything else over 48 hours. If error budgets dip, flip the global kill switch and ping whoever's on rotation. Before you push the signed flag bundle to the distribution bucket, double-check you're using the current key, pasted here for convenience.

rollout seal: bky3_Zik